Transaction e9d4aefb31652276a9e756b4d542b4f6240897d8cc69b5c7e1dc42f80ccbb703

4 Input
1 Outputs
  • e9d4aefb31652276a9e756b4d542b4f6240897d8cc69b5c7e1dc42f80ccbb703:0
  • value  2285139
    address  34FJafe7M4mbNciqWWvMHdfYCdSdHvK5sr